为什么要将每次最优化结果返回本地DNS服务器?

来源:1-8 Linux网络基础之DNS作用

fangshuiyu

2015-11-16 17:47

直接将要查询的IP地址和源IP地址通过根服务器层层下传,然后让最后那个目标主机将内容和自己的IP地址直接返回源主机不就行了,中间还要那么多次返回最优结果给本地服务器,这不是浪费时间吗?

写回答 关注

3回答

  • wulongtao
    2016-05-18 21:50:06

    返回给本地服务器我认为有两个作用:1本地服务器可以保存ip地址和对应的域名3天时间,当再次访问的时候,直接拿来就可以用了,不用那么麻烦了!  2当每台电脑都访问根服务器的话,根服务器的压力是不是很大啊!

    fangsh...

    你们到底有没有看懂我写的,他的流程是每次一级级往上找,这级没找到,告诉它哪一级可能有,然后再让客户端去访问那一级,为什么不干脆这级服务器没找到,它直接把请求客户端的IP和他要找的IP传给可能知道的那个服务器,如果他知道这个IP地址,直接把相应内容发给请求的那个客户端不就完了,何必又要多次一举,让客户端多次周转,这跟根服务器压力大有什么关系,本来就要有这一次访问的,又不可能避免,只是现在换成了下一级服务器直接来访问而已,而且最后那个发送数据的目标服务器一样可以保存IP地址,完全没有任何区别

    2016-05-19 12:50:40

    共 1 条回复 >

  • fruitchan
    2016-01-07 20:53:40

    网络请求不单是带有IP地址,还带有需要发送的数据,全部通过根服务器来传输是不现实的。

    共 1 条回复 >

  • benet1006
    2015-11-29 15:10:38

    你读得学校是天大吗?哪里见过你

    fangsh...

    不是,你肯定是见过头像吧,很多人用这个星爷的头像

    2015-11-30 13:57:40

    共 1 条回复 >

Linux网络管理

为你带来Linux网络环境搭建,介绍远程登录工具的使用

114246 学习 · 410 问题

查看课程

相似问题